MECHANIC FALLS – Sandra A. Ballard, 81, of Mechanic Falls, passed away June 17, 2024, after a courageous battle with cancer.

She was born Nov. 1, 1942, in Raymond, to parents Jim and Dot Plummer. She graduated from Mechanic Falls High School in 1961.

She was a stay-at-home mom for many years and during that time she babysat many children. She was a lunch lady at the Molly Ockett School in Fryeburg for many years.

She was predeceased by her husband of 52 years Stacy Ballard; her parents, Jim and Dot Plummer; daughter-in-law Ronda Ballard; son-in-law Gary Gravel; brothers, Preston (Kickie) Plummer and Randy Plummer, sister-in-law Joan Plummer; and niece Theresa Emery.

She is survived by children Michelle, Michael (Jen), Melissa (Jim), Mark (Tammy) and daughters Rosalie (Roger), Terri (Phillip), 15 grandchildren and 16 great-grandchildren.

She is also survived by siblings, Jimmy (Ruth), Sheila (Chubb), Penny (Bud), Billy, Ricky (Lori), Rudy and Claudia (Dan); and many nieces and nephews.
